For anyone who doesn't know 'Flood' its avalible on the double 7" vinyl concept album with-in the 4 seasons boxset.

'The Chelsea Hotel Oral Sex Song' can be heard on the first album 'The Last Time I Did Acid I Went Insane'.
You can also find live versions avalible for download on the downloads page in the
'2004/02/18 - London lock 17' gig and the 'MO#FO Festival day 2' gig
